Muhlenberg College Recognized for Financial Value, ROI by ‘Money’ Magazine
Money's methodology evaluates colleges based on factors including educational quality, affordability, graduation rates and alumni earnings.By: Kristine Yahna Todaro Monday, June 17, 2024 10:52 AM

Muhlenberg has been awarded a 4.5-star rating by Money magazine in its 2024 Best Colleges list, reflecting the College’s dedication to academic excellence and support for student outcomes.
Money's methodology evaluated the top 745 four-year institutions in the United States, using various data points to apply a 1- to 5-star rating system. The methodology emphasized key indicators such as graduation rates, average student debt, alumni earnings and return on investment (ROI).
